在使用golang语言进行编程时,我们经常会遇到需要在linux平台下进行编译的情况。而了解如何正确地进行golang编译linux是至关重要的。 首先,为了在linux平台下进行golang编译,我们需要在linux系统上安装golang编译器。通常情况下,golang编译器是通过包管理器来安装的,比如在Ubuntu系统上可以通过apt-get工具来安装。安装完毕后,我们就可以开始在linux
原创 2024-04-29 11:20:06
168阅读
1、GO命令一览  GO提供了很多命令,包括打包、格式化代码、文档生成、下载第三方包等等诸多功能,我们可以通过在控制台下执行 go 来查看内置的所有命令  下面来逐个介绍,也可以详细参考 https://github.com/hyper-carrot/go_command_tutorial 2、go build  这个命令可以直接使用,也可以带上代码包或源码文件使用。  如果是
转载 2023-10-10 23:06:46
3706阅读
Linux系统中部署Golang环境是一个常见的需求,特别是对于开发人员来说。Golang是一种由Google开发的编程语言,它具有高效的并发性和简洁的语法,因此受到了广泛的关注和应用。 要在Linux系统上成功部署Golang环境,我们通常需要遵循以下步骤: 1. 下载Golang安装包:首先,我们需要从Golang官方网站上下载适用于Linux系统的Golang安装包。我们可以选择下载二
原创 2024-04-07 09:50:14
198阅读
Linux安装Golang环境 Golang(又称为Go)是一种开源的编程语言,由Google开发。它具有简洁、快速和高效的特点,被广泛应用于各种领域的软件开发。在Linux操作系统上安装Golang环境可以为开发者提供一个强大的工具链,帮助他们编写高性能和可扩展的应用程序。本文将介绍如何在Linux系统上安装Golang环境,并为想要开始使用Golang的开发者提供一些基础知识和使用技巧。
原创 2024-02-05 15:43:34
348阅读
Linux系统中设置Golang环境是一个非常重要的步骤,因为Golang是一种强大的编程语言,被广泛用于开发各种类型的应用程序。在本文中,我们将讨论如何在Linux系统中设置Golang环境。 首先,我们需要下载Golang的安装包。我们可以从Golang官方网站(https://golang.org/dl/)下载最新版本的Golang。一般来说,我们可以选择Linux版本的安装包,通常是一
原创 2024-04-08 09:59:22
40阅读
Go  语言现在是越来越火了,出现在各个领域中,称它为 21 世纪的 C 语言一点都不为过,而且 Go 语言是 2009  年才发布的新语言,可以说它的特性是完全基于现代计算机来设计的,尤其是它的看家本领 goroutine  协程,在高并发场景下使用简直不要太爽,非常适合写一些高性能中间件。而作为  Java 后端开发者的我,早在 2017 年底的时候已经通过业余时间掌握了 Go 语言,并且还手
转载 2021-06-07 06:24:38
476阅读
现在越来越多的开发者开始拥抱Go语言了,那么开发Go程序肯定得有Go的环境,而项目的服务器部署的话一般除了目前的容器技术,原生的Linux方式部署我们也是需要掌握的,那么今天我就在Linux上安装Go环境做个简单介绍。 一、官网下载 首先打开官网链接 https://go.dev/dl/,进入到官网后首页有个Download,直接点击即可进行下载界面,选择合适的版本,因为我们要在Linux服务
原创 2024-06-15 12:47:39
457阅读
命令行安装 yum install golang 默认安装目录/usr/lib/golang/ (不同系统不一样,可通过搜
原创 2022-08-21 00:21:10
552阅读
GoLang
原创 2018-03-16 16:07:28
319阅读
这里以Windows7 64位为例,如果是32位环境需安装对应版本程序。一、安装golang1.2.21.3及1.3.1编译生成的二进制文件,无法使用LiteIDE23.2携带的gdb7.7进行调试。二、安装及配置LiteIDE将liteidex23.2.windows.7z解压到D:\即完成安装。2.1 设置编辑环境因为是64位环境,所以选择“win64”。查看->编辑环境变量,确认GOR
Linux 编译环境是红帽操作系统中十分重要的一个组成部分。它提供了一套完整的工具链,可以将高级编程语言的源代码转化成可执行文件。本文将讨论Linux编译环境的重要性以及如何在红帽操作系统上搭建一个高效的编译环境。 首先,我们来探讨Linux编译环境的重要性。随着软件行业的不断发展,越来越多的应用程序需要在Linux系统上进行开发和使用。而编译环境作为软件开发和部署的基础,其重要性不言而喻。一个
原创 2024-02-02 11:13:03
133阅读
实验四 Linux系统搭建C语言编程环境项目内容这个作业属于哪个课程<2020春季Linux系统与应用 >这个作业的要求在哪里<实验四 Linux系统搭建C语言编程环境>学号-姓名<17043101-李绍斌>作业学习目标1.了解Linux系统C语言编程环境;2.学习Linux环境C语言开发步骤1.安装C语言开发环境查看gcc版本信息查看make版本2.简单C语言
转载 2024-03-29 21:23:54
55阅读
实验四 linux系统搭建c语言编程环境1.安装语言开发环境sudo apt install build-seeentia1 查看gcc版本信息gcc -v2 查看make版本信息2.简单c语言练习1 通过man命令查看帮助文档 man gcc2 命令行模式简单c语言编译链接等操作我们可以通过vim编辑器编写一个最简单的C语言程序,如写一个输出自己学号的程序。先创建一个文 件夹,然后进入
## 在Windows环境下使用Golang编译Linux ARM架构的程序 在当今的开发环境中,Go语言以其简洁的语法与强大的并发能力而受到广泛的欢迎。然而,对于许多开发者来说,跨平台构建仍然是一个重要的挑战。本文将详细介绍如何在Windows环境下为Linux ARM架构编译Go程序。 ### 1. Go语言简介 Go语言,也称为Golang,是由Google研发的一门编程语言,旨在提升
原创 9月前
785阅读
Linux系统中,环境变量是非常重要的概念,它可以帮助用户在系统中设置和管理各种参数和配置信息。而在使用Golang编程语言开发程序时,也会涉及到环境变量的使用。本文将重点介绍在Linux系统下如何设置和管理Golang环境变量。 首先,需要了解GolangLinux系统下的安装路径。一般来说,Golang的安装路径为`/usr/local/go`,当我们在Linux系统上安装Golang
原创 2024-05-27 11:06:51
161阅读
在进行golang开发时,搭建一个合适的开发环境是非常重要的。而在Linux操作系统上搭建golang开发环境则是一个非常常见且有效的选择。本文将介绍如何在Linux系统上搭建golang开发环境,帮助开发者们更好地进行golang开发工作。 首先,我们需要下载并安装golang。在Linux系统上,我们可以通过包管理器来安装golang。以Red Hat系列的操作系统为例,可以使用以下命令来安
原创 2024-04-30 09:46:09
102阅读
Linux编译环境下的交叉编译是一种在一台计算机上构建在另一个不同架构的计算机上运行的程序的技术。这种技术在嵌入式系统开发以及跨平台开发中得到广泛应用,尤其是在处理器不同的情况下。在Linux系统中,交叉编译环境通常用于开发针对嵌入式系统的应用程序。 为了实现交叉编译,首先需要配置一个交叉编译工具链,它包含了一个交叉编译器、交叉链接器、交叉调试器等工具。这些工具链通常是针对特定的目标平台和操作系
原创 2024-03-15 10:52:33
152阅读
作为一名软件工程师,确保你的代码高效且性能良好是非常重要的。本文主要和大家分享5个可以在Golang中优化代码以提高性能的技巧,希望对大家有所帮助 作为一名软件工程师,确保你的代码高效且性能良好是非常重要的。在Golang中,有几个最佳实践和技术可以用来优化你的代码,以获得更好的性能。这里有五个技巧可以帮助你开始工作:1.明智地使用指针。Golang使用指针来引用内存位置。虽然指针
本文来自小米信息技术团队,作者为小米信息技术部海外商城组何磊1. 认识 go build当我们敲下 go build 的时候,我们写的源码文件究竟经历了哪些事情,最终变成了可执行文件?这个命令会编译 go 代码,今天就来一起看看 go 的编译过程吧!首先先来认识以下 go 的代码源文件分类命令源码文件:简单说就是含有 main 函数的那个文件,通常一个项目一个该文件,我也没想过
转载 2023-11-15 13:22:44
70阅读
实验四 Linux系统搭建C语言编译环境项目内容这个作业属于哪个课程班级课程的主页链接这个作业的要求在哪里作业要求学号-姓名17043108-张毅作业学习目标1. Linux系统下C语言开发环境搭建学习 2.Linux系统环境C语言开发过程1.安装C语言开发环境a)安装开发环境sudo apt install build-essentialb)查看gcc的版本gcc -vc)查看make版本信息m
  • 1
  • 2
  • 3
  • 4
  • 5